Body’s Quiet Cries for Rest
You’re Always Mentally Foggy
Struggling to concentrate, forgetting things, or zoning out? Brain fog is a clear sign your body and mind are running on empty.
Sore Eyes and Light Sensitivity
Burning eyes or trouble with screens could mean more than eye strain—it often signals fatigue and the need for serious rest.
You Feel Irritated Easily
If tiny things suddenly annoy you, it might be exhaustion—not personality. Mental fatigue lowers emotional tolerance and patience.
Minor Tasks Feel Overwhelming
When doing laundry or replying to texts feels like climbing Everest, it’s your nervous system telling you it needs a full reset.
You Keep Getting Sick
Frequent colds or headaches? A run-down immune system is a biological clue that your body’s energy bank is dangerously low.
Cravings for Junk Spike
When tired, your body seeks quick energy via sugar or salt. Intense cravings can indicate low physical stamina and stress overload.
Constant Muscle Aches
Random aches or soreness without a workout often point to fatigue or sleep deprivation—not injury or aging.
